Knowing HDB & BTO Defect Checks in Singapore
Embarking on property acquisition in Singapore via HDB or BTO involves a crucial step: the defect check. It's your window to meticulously scrutinize the unit for any building issues before officially accepting it. This procedure isn’t merely about finding minor cosmetic problems; it's about ensuring the integrity of your new home. Several first-time buyers often find overwhelmed, unsure of what to identify or how to properly record findings. A thorough check usually involves reviewing items like surface coating, window fittings, floor tiling, and door performance. Bear in mind that having a knowledgeable friend or engaging a professional inspector can significantly improve the impact of your investigation. Following the check, lodge a form to HDB detailing all discovered issues, allowing them to schedule for repair works to be carried out. This framework protects your investment and helps maintain the high quality of public accommodation in the country.

Navigating Singapore Defect Assessments: BTO & HDB – A Detailed Guide
Securing a new flat in Singapore, whether through a Build-to-Order (Fresh) project or a Housing & Development Board) HDB flat, is a significant milestone. However, it’s crucial to thoroughly inspect your residence for any defects before website accepting it. This guide breaks down the defect examination process for both BTO and HDB flats, providing a straightforward step-by-step method. Initially, you'll receive a initial inspection session from your developer or HDB. Prepare yourself by carefully examining the HDB's defect resolution guide beforehand, which outlines common issues. During the viewing, systematically check all areas - walls, floors, ceilings, fixtures, and equipment. Don't hesitate to document any imperfections with photos and clear descriptions. Following, officially lodge your defect report within the stipulated deadline. Remember to keep records of all communications related to the defect repair process, as this acts as important proof should further assistance be required. Ultimately, a meticulous defect inspection protects your investment and ensures you receive a quality flat.
